Should I have so many side effects with sertaline 50mg

Posted , 7 users are following.

Hi,

I've been on sertaline for 6 days now for anxiety and the side effects have been horrible.

I've had..

Headaches

Nausea

Diorea

dry mouth

Teeth grinding

cold sweats

Freezing cold

Strange dreams

dizziness

Shaking hands

Stomach cramps

tiredness

Feeling and looking spaced out

feeling more anxious than ever... has anyone had all of these side effects or am I supposed to only have some...

    Hi All,

    Im almost 9 weeks in now on 50mgs and feel a whole lot calmer and feel more level....

    I was fortunate in the fact that although I did suffer pretty much all of the side effects they were never severe and I always told myself "its just the pills doing it and it will go away", I always walked around with a bottle of water to stop myself getting dehydrated which I think causes alot of the headaches. Iam self employed and havent really had the option to sit around too much and have to get out of bed every day to make sure things are getting done, My concentration levels are all over the place, I try to set myself daily manageable targets but not be hard on myself if I dont manage to meet them.

    I think sometimes some of the side effects seem alot worse if you have time to dwell on them, I used to grind my teeth quite alot especially when stressed, Iam now finding that Im lightly gritting my teeth whilst pushing my tongue up, or lightly tapping my teeth together which combined with the metallic taste Im getting is quite bizarre but still its just one of the effects and I dont let it wind me up.

    Hope that helps some of you with apprehension over if you should stick with it wink
